[QUOTE="Fabriart, post: 6696906, member: 304477"] Poker is a game of skill, strategy, and decision-making that involves not only technical aspects but also the mental aspect. While many poker players focus on improving their technical skills, it is essential to recognize the importance of mental health for long-term performance. In this article, we will explore the relationship between poker and mental health, and how it is possible to cultivate a healthy balance to achieve success at the tables. [B]Managing Pressure:[/B] Poker can be an extremely challenging and competitive game, which can lead to high-pressure situations. The ability to effectively manage stress and emotional pressure is crucial for maintaining good performance. Players who neglect their mental health may experience issues such as anxiety, excessive stress, and even depression. It is important to recognize the signs of stress and seek strategies to cope with these emotions. [B]Practicing Self-control:[/B] In poker, just like in any gambling game, there are external factors that are beyond our control. Dealing with variance and inevitable losses is part of the game. Developing self-control skills is crucial to avoid emotional tilts, which occur when a player lets negative emotions take over after a series of losses. It is necessary to maintain composure, make rational decisions, and not let emotions interfere with the game. [B]Balancing Personal Life and the Game:[/B] An aspect often overlooked by poker players is the importance of maintaining a balance between personal life and the game. Spending long hours at the tables without dedicating time to other activities can lead to mental overload and even health problems. It is essential to find a healthy balance between poker and other aspects of life, such as family, friends, hobbies, and physical activities. Having a balanced life provides a solid foundation for facing the challenges of the game in a healthier way. [B]Seeking Support:[/B] Just like anyone going through mental challenges, poker players can benefit from the support of professionals. Psychologists specialized in dealing with athletes and players can help develop emotional skills, improve decision-making, and provide strategies to cope with the pressures of the game. Seeking professional support is not a sign of weakness but rather a smart way to invest in your mental well-being and long-term performance. [I][B]Conclusion:[/B] Poker is a game that requires technical and mental skills. It is important to recognize that mental health plays a crucial role in long-term success. Managing stress, practicing self-control, balancing personal life, and seeking support are essential for maintaining mental well-being in the world of poker. By nurturing a healthy mental state, players can enhance their abilities and achieve greater success in the game while maintaining overall well-being.[/I] [/QUOTE]
